HPV vaccine: is it for dirty people only?
Back in the late 90s I attended a medical conference in a medical college in Lahore when the speaker, a professor of dermatology, declared HIV/AIDS patients as sinners. It was more than a decade after HIV discovery, but the stigma surrounding HIV was still at its peak. He called it God's punishment on those people who are homosexuals. The whole auditorium applauded this "Islamic touch", and the speaker's face was gleaming with joy and pride once he concluded his speech.
It was not a very new disease then and at least this professor should have known that HIV is not exclusively spread by homosexuals, but there are other routes of transmission too. When he asked questions from the audience, I raised my hand. He was so happy with the audience response that he allowed me to ask the question.
I said, "Sir, are the newborns who get HIV from their mothers also being punished? If yes, for what sins?"
